Chutroniyon Ki Dhani Population - Barmer, Rajasthan

Chutroniyon Ki Dhani is a medium size village located in Baytoo Tehsil of Barmer district, Rajasthan with total 110 families residing. The Chutroniyon Ki Dhani village has population of 616 of which 311 are males while 305 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Chutroniyon Ki Dhani village population of children with age 0-6 is 102 which makes up 16.56 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Chutroniyon Ki Dhani village is 981 which is higher than Rajasthan state average of 928. Child Sex Ratio for the Chutroniyon Ki Dhani as per census is 1040, higher than Rajasthan average of 888.

Chutroniyon Ki Dhani village has higher literacy rate compared to Rajasthan. In 2011, literacy rate of Chutroniyon Ki Dhani village was 72.96 % compared to 66.11 % of Rajasthan. In Chutroniyon Ki Dhani Male literacy stands at 84.67 % while female literacy rate was 60.87 %.

Caste Factor

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 12.01 % of total population in Chutroniyon Ki Dhani village. The village Chutroniyon Ki Dhani currently doesn’t have any Schedule Tribe (ST) population.

Work Profile

In Chutroniyon Ki Dhani village out of total population, 336 were engaged in work activities. 11.61 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 88.39 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 336 workers engaged in Main Work, 1 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 0 were Agricultural labourer.
